Subject: Roof-terrace door jamming again

Facilities,

Third report this week: the roof-terrace door at Bramleigh Tower sticks after closing and staff get stranded outside. Joiner from Pellick & Sons booked for Thursday morning. Until fixed, terrace access is supervised only — prop bar removed, signage up. If you need to inspect the mechanism before Thursday, go via the Level 9 stairwell, not the lift lobby. Log each entry in the terrace book at reception. Use the override code below.

— Front Desk

staff pass of kawip-hawef = bdg-QLP-2

RUNBOOK 4.2 — Calibration Weights Dispatch

Batch KW-7 (twelve certified weights, Class F) ships from the Tarnley depot to the Ostwick metrology lab. Verify seals on each case, record tare values on the shift log, and keep cases upright at all times. Confirm the van is climate-stable before loading. Follow the hand-over instruction below exactly.

courier memo of yawep-yafog: the pramir ulaix courier leaves the ulavan aldix frair zorok oliiel joreth rusdor fenvan ledger at gate 1305 under passcode 514738

## Per-Tenant Rate Quotas

Quotas for Spindrift API tenants live in the limits table, enforced at the gateway. Pages usually mean one tenant blew past burst allowance. Check their quota row, bump temporarily if legit, file a follow-up. To query the limits table directly, connect with the string below.

primary connection of yagep-kahip = redis://giliel_svc:zYiKsLL2PLpfPL@db-348f.xolmarsys.corp:5432/fenwyn